Package org.apache.camel.vault
Class VaultConfiguration
java.lang.Object
org.apache.camel.vault.VaultConfiguration
- Direct Known Subclasses:
AwsVaultConfiguration
,AzureVaultConfiguration
,GcpVaultConfiguration
,HashicorpVaultConfiguration
,IBMSecretsManagerVaultConfiguration
,KubernetesConfigMapVaultConfiguration
,KubernetesVaultConfiguration
,SpringCloudConfigConfiguration
Base configuration for access to Vaults.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ionaws()
AWS Vault Configurationazure()
Azure Vault Configurationgcp()
GCP Vault ConfigurationHashicorp Vault ConfigurationIBM Secrets Manager Vault ConfigurationKubernetes Vault ConfigurationKubernetes Configmaps Vault Configurationvoid
void
void
void
void
setIBMSecretsManagerVaultConfiguration
(IBMSecretsManagerVaultConfiguration ibmSecretsManager) void
setKubernetesConfigMapVaultConfiguration
(KubernetesConfigMapVaultConfiguration kubernetesConfigmaps) void
void
setSpringCloudConfigConfiguration
(SpringCloudConfigConfiguration springCloudConfigConfiguration)
-
Constructor Details
-
VaultConfiguration
public VaultConfiguration()
-
-
Method Details
-
aws
AWS Vault Configuration -
gcp
GCP Vault Configuration -
azure
Azure Vault Configuration -
hashicorp
Hashicorp Vault Configuration -
kubernetes
Kubernetes Vault Configuration -
kubernetesConfigmaps
Kubernetes Configmaps Vault Configuration -
ibmSecretsManager
IBM Secrets Manager Vault Configuration -
springConfig
-
getAwsVaultConfiguration
-
setAwsVaultConfiguration
-
getGcpVaultConfiguration
-
setGcpVaultConfiguration
-
getAzureVaultConfiguration
-
setAzureVaultConfiguration
-
getHashicorpVaultConfiguration
-
setHashicorpVaultConfiguration
-
getKubernetesVaultConfiguration
-
setKubernetesVaultConfiguration
-
getKubernetesConfigMapVaultConfiguration
-
setKubernetesConfigMapVaultConfiguration
public void setKubernetesConfigMapVaultConfiguration(KubernetesConfigMapVaultConfiguration kubernetesConfigmaps) -
getIBMSecretsManagerVaultConfiguration
-
setIBMSecretsManagerVaultConfiguration
public void setIBMSecretsManagerVaultConfiguration(IBMSecretsManagerVaultConfiguration ibmSecretsManager) -
getSpringCloudConfigConfiguration
-
setSpringCloudConfigConfiguration
public void setSpringCloudConfigConfiguration(SpringCloudConfigConfiguration springCloudConfigConfiguration)
-